## Authentication

The Harvestline gateway accepts only bearer auth over TLS 1.3. Tokens are minted by the Plowshare identity service, scoped per tractor fleet, and expire after 12 hours. No API keys, no basic auth. Rotation is enforced server-side; revoked tokens fail closed. Rate limits apply per token, not per IP. Telemetry writes require the `ingest` scope. For review purposes, use the staging credential below.

session JWT of yawep-yawep = eyJhbGciOiJIUzI1NiIsInR5cCI6IkpXVCJ9.eyJzdWIiOiI3pWF3_In0.aXYsHiog

### Runbook: Account Recovery — Ledgerette Payroll Export

Heads up, future maintainer: after the v7 format change, Ledgerette's payroll export service uses a new service account. If that account gets locked mid-export, old creds won't work — you'll need the recovery flow instead. Kick it off from the admin CLI, then supply the passphrase shown below when prompted.

strongbox words: zorath-holmir

RUNBOOK — Account recovery, Marleth DNS flake

Symptom: recovery emails from the Orvane identity service intermittently fail; resolver in the Bexley cluster returns stale NXDOMAIN for the mailer host. Check resolver cache TTLs first. If stale, flush the cache on both Marleth nodes and retry. Do not restart the identity service itself — it drops pending recovery tokens. If flushing fails, fail over to the secondary resolver and escalate. Secondary access requires unsealing the ops vault; enter the recovery passphrase printed below.

strongbox words: praath-queniel-holax-druael-jorath-noveth-druok

Subject: Reportly cut-over done — sorting is stable now

Hey support crew,

We flipped Reportly to the new sort engine last night. Ties in grouped reports now keep their original row order instead of shuffling on every refresh, so those "my report keeps rearranging" tickets should dry up. Old saved reports were migrated automatically. If a customer still sees jumpy rows, check the values below before escalating.

config for kajog-tadug:
[casax]
port = 11211
region = west-3
host = casax.nelvroworks.internal
timeout_ms = 5000
retries = 7